Stany Coppet is a French actor of mixed origins. His origins are from French Guiana and French Britany. He grew up between Paris and Cayenne. Stany Coppet lived in New York and Los Angeles for many years. He studied acting at the Lee Strasberg Theatre and Film Institute of New York and started out his career on stage in small production in New York.
His professional career first started in France in Orpailleur directed by Marc Barrat and TV series such as R.I.S or Section De Recherche on TF1. In 2011 Stany gets a major role in Spain as the main villain of the movie Aguila Roja. Since then he multiplied villains part in different productions such as the Biopic Toussaint Louverture for French TV, in he portrayed the hateful General Rigaud.
Stany Coppet is also the creator of the show From Slavery To Freedom, which he produced for the first time in 2008 in South America, then at the City hall of Paris, at the US Embassy of Paris, and more recently in New York in 2011.

Wilson was an actor and singer with experience onstage as well as in front of, and behind, the camera lens. His notable film and television roles include: "People Magazine Investigates" (2016), "Girl on the Side" (2018) and "Inner Child" (2017).
Outside of his filmography, Wilson performed as the lead in dozens of stage productions, and he directed a number of his own theater pieces. "Noah is a disciplined, self-motivated, student of the arts. He directed a selection, "Confrontation", from 'Jekyll & Hyde'. Noah was passionate about the musical. Noah restructured harmonies, built one beautiful stage image after another, and developed an arch to his storytelling that rivaled professional work I have seen. He spent countless hours working with the material and the cast, and when the number was presented it was far and away the audience favorite" (Kyle Lewis, MFA, AEA, SDC Artistic Director at Tuacahn).
A native of St. George, Utah, Noah developed an interest for the arts at an early age. He attended Tuacahn High School for the Performing Arts and graduated Valedictorian. After attending Brigham Young University, Noah auditioned for NYU's Tisch School of the Arts, and he was accepted into the Atlantic Acting School. He opted to defer his acceptance to NYU, and he went to Los Angeles to try his hand at film and television work. After an eventful and successful two years, he chose to complete his education, enrolling at the University of San Diego to study Environmental Ocean Science and Fine Arts.

Gaston Gagnon has been involved in the music business since an early age. As a teenager, he learned to play the guitar listening to master guitarists Jeff Beck, Eric Clapton and other greats... Born in Quebec, Canada, Gaston joined a wide variety of bands, alternating between rock music and his main love affair ...blues. He's the main axeman behind the sound of "Garolou", a leading folk-rock band which already has one gold record to their credit and was voted twice best folk album of the year (Gala de l'ADISQ - QC/Canada, 1980). Over the years, Gaston has performed with some great Canadian bluesmen including Juno award winner Ray Bonneville, harp wizard Jim Zeller, singer Bob Walsh and boogie man Alan Gerber. Performing around the world like the Nyon Folk Festival in Switzerland, the Montreal International Jazz Festival, and the prestigious Carnegie Hall in New-York, to name a few, Gaston showed a versatility and sensitivity appreciated by all . As a guitar player, accompanying various artists, he's opened for John Lee Hooker, B.B. King, Joe Cocker, John Mayall and Johnny Winter. More recently, he has joined forces with bluesman Denis Parker and together they offer a wide variety of soulful blues classics to originals that stand on their own merit. Gaston Gagnon is also a member of the progressive rock band "Existence" where his inventive guitar work brings an aura of space and musicality to this intricate group. Leading his own band, the power and originality of Gaston's guitar shines upon the music not to mention the raw smoky blues voice he delivers in his own songs as well as blues classics. A recording engineer as well, Gaston has worked in Newfoundland with producer Don Walsh, Don Walsh, helping him get the best out of the recordings from Canada's east coast. Credits include ECMA nominees "Snotty Var" and Denis Parker's "Snowman Blues". Benedicte Beaugeois discovered the artistic world very early in life through music, dance and theater. In middle school, she integrated the rigorous schedules of the "Conservatoire de Musique et Danse de Yerres" (Music and Dance school). Upon completing high school, she decided to go to film school and specialize in film production. Ms Beaugeois has since worked for animation film production companies as well as short and feature-length film production and currenty works at Peermusic France and studies at l'école du Louvre.
